Advantages of Private Mental Health ServicesPersonalized Care
In a private setting, mental health specialists can tailor treatment plans to fit the individual's requirements. This level of personalization can cause much better results, as professionals can change methods based upon real-time feedback.
Much Shorter Wait Times
Many private facilities boast much shorter wait times compared to public alternatives. This can be important for those requiring instant support or treatment.
Greater Privacy
Patients frequently feel more comfy discussing delicate issues in [private psychiatry clinic](https://hackmd.okfn.de/s/rJIl7UpFWl) settings, which can lead to more open and effective interaction with their therapists.
Access to Specialized Services
Private mental health services typically consist of specialists for specific conditions or treatment methods, such as cognitive behavioral treatment (CBT), dialectical habits treatment (DBT), and more.
Versatile Appointment Times
Private providers typically offer more flexible scheduling, accommodating various private schedules, which might be challenging in public settings.
3. Downsides of Private Mental Health ServicesCost
Among the most substantial drawbacks of [private psychiatry practice](https://posteezy.com/why-we-love-private-psychiatric-assessment-and-you-should-also) mental health services is the cost. While some individuals find the expenditure worthwhile, others might have problem with affordability, particularly if insurance coverage is restricted.
Variable Quality
The quality of care can differ significantly amongst private specialists. Unlike public systems, there may be fewer policies in place to guarantee their qualifications or adherence to basic practices.
Insurance Limitations
Patients might experience difficulties with insurance coverage as not all mental health services are covered by private insurance plans. Understanding protection options is essential before seeking treatment.
Restricted Availability of Emergency Services
Some private practices might not offer emergency situation services or may just deal with scheduled appointments. This restriction can be concerning for individuals in crisis situations.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: How do I find a private mental health service provider?
A: You can begin by seeking recommendations from family or buddies, browsing online directory sites, or calling your insurance provider for covered professionals.
Q2: Will my insurance coverage cover private mental health services?
A: Coverage varies by strategy. Contact your insurance company to understand what services are covered and what out-of-pocket costs to anticipate.
Q3: How do I understand if a private company is certified?
A: Ensure that the supplier has the proper credentials and licensure. You can check expert associations or websites for verification.
Q4: Can I change mental health service providers?
A: Yes, clients can switch suppliers if they feel their requirements are much better suited somewhere else.
